CRYSTAL STRUCTURE OF a DUF72 family protein (EF0366) FROM ENTEROCOCCUS FAECALIS V583 AT 2.52 A RESOLUTION
Experimental procedure
| Experimental method | MAD |
| Source type | SYNCHROTRON |
| Source details | ALS BEAMLINE 8.3.1 |
| Synchrotron site | ALS |
| Beamline | 8.3.1 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2004-08-27 |
| Detector | ADSC |
| Wavelength(s) | 0.979694, 0.979571, 1.019859 |
| Spacegroup name | P 65 |
| Unit cell lengths | 114.079, 114.079, 52.307 |
|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
| Resolution | 28.520 - 2.520 |
| R-factor | 0.22652 |
| Rwork | 0.225 |
| R-free | 0.25697 |
| Structure solution method | MAD |
| RMSD bond length | 0.011 |
| RMSD bond angle | 1.306 |
| Data reduction software | MOSFLM |
| Data scaling software | SCALA (CCP4 4.2) |
| Phasing software | SHARP |
| Refinement software | REFMAC (5.2.0005)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 28.520 | 2.660 |
| High resolution limit [Å] | 2.520 | 2.520 |
| Number of reflections | 13332 | |
| <I/σ(I)> | 9.1 | 1.8 |
| Completeness [%] | 99.9 | 100 |
| Redundancy | 6.5 | 6.5 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, SITTING DROP, NANODROP | 4.5 | 277 | 10.0% PEG-3000, 0.2M Zn(OAc)2, 0.1M Acetate, VAPOR DIFFUSION, SITTING DROP, NANODROP, temperature 277K, pH 4.5 |
